SCADAMaster, правильно ли я Вас понял, что мне надо узнать время запрос-ответ каждого прибора "висящего" на одном ком-порте, сложить полученное время, данное число и будет минимальным временем, за которое опс вернется к опросу каждого устройства? а возможно например опрашивать устройство "А" каждые 2 секунды, а "Б" например каждые 500мс?
Да, выясните за какое время опрашивается каждое устройство. Если в сумме выйдет больше секунды, то оставьте все настройки (в том числе в скаде) по умолчанию - 1000 мс.
Спасибо.
SCADAMaster если я создам событие, которое будет считывать признак качества значения OPCQuality( ), то будет считываться только "Ошибка Устройства" как написано в справке, или еще "ошибку датчика" и "Значение не определено" я смогу увидеть?
С помощью этой функции можно вернуть все признаки качества переменной, в том числе и перечисленные вами.
Спасибо.
Получается в истину будет переходить событие от любой ошибки прописанной в скрипте в ОПС? Мне для этого ничего добавлять не нужно? И еще, что такое "снять признак качества"?
OPCQuality(Значение) = НЕОПРЕДЕЛЕНО ИЛИ OPCQuality(Значение) =ОШИБКА_УСТРОЙСТВА ИЛИ OPCQuality(Значение) =ОШИБКА_ДАТЧИКА
Должно быть вот так прописано? правильно я понял?
Есть еще одна ДИЛЕ́ММА, с аналоговых модулей я могу принимать значение с одних регистров в int и передавать также в скаду, там в свою очередь делить число, получая нужное значение с запятой, или же из других регистров считывать и передавать float, и в скаде уже ничего не делать, так каким путем все таки идти? что быстрей и меньше грузит и ОПС и СКАДУ?